How Do Different Materials Impact the Weight of a Lacrosse Stick?

The weight of a lacrosse stick is affected by the materials used in its construction, which can include aluminum, composite, and plastic. Each material has specific characteristics that influence the overall weight and performance of the stick.

  • Aluminum: Lacrosse sticks made from aluminum are generally lightweight and durable. Aluminum provides a good strength-to-weight ratio, resulting in sticks that are easy to handle and maneuver. According to a study by the Sports Science Journal (Smith, 2022), aluminum sticks typically weigh between 5 to 7 ounces.

  • Composite: Composite materials, such as carbon fiber or fiberglass, are commonly used for higher-end lacrosse sticks. These materials are lighter than aluminum while maintaining strength and stiffness. The same study notes that composite sticks can weigh as little as 4 ounces, offering enhanced performance without the added weight.

  • Plastic: Some recreational and youth lacrosse sticks are made from high-density plastic. These sticks tend to be heavier and less durable than aluminum or composite options. Their weight can range from 7 to 10 ounces. A review in the Journal of Sports Equipment (Jones, 2023) highlighted that plastic sticks are ideal for beginners due to their affordability and sturdiness, despite their increased weight.

  • Performance Impact: The weight of a lacrosse stick can influence a player’s speed, control, and overall performance. Heavier sticks may provide more power during shots but can decrease maneuverability. In contrast, lighter sticks offer increased control and quicker movements, thus impacting gameplay strategies.

By understanding these materials and their effects on weight, players can choose the right lacrosse stick to suit their performance needs and personal preferences.

How Do Various Shaft Shapes Affect the Dynamic Weight Distribution of Lacrosse Sticks?

Shaft shapes significantly influence the dynamic weight distribution of lacrosse sticks, affecting performance and player control. The following key points explain how these shapes impact weight distribution and overall function:

  • Shape Geometry: Different shaft shapes result in different distribution of material across the stick. For example, a traditional round shaft has uniform weight distribution, while an elliptical or tapered shaft creates a more dynamic center of gravity. This impacts how players handle and maneuver the stick.

  • Material Composition: The choice of material affects weight perception. Carbon fiber shafts are lightweight, enhancing speed and control. Aluminum shafts, while heavier, may provide better strength and durability. This difference in material can lead to varied dynamic weight distributions during play.

  • Flex Profile: Shafts may have different flex points. A shaft with a lower flex point bends closer to the head, transferring energy more efficiently during shots. This flex alters the dynamic weight distribution, allowing for a more powerful release.

  • Length and Diameter: Longer shafts often shift weight towards the back, which can influence balance. Thicker shafts may distribute weight more evenly than slimmer shafts. This affects how players feel the stick during play, possibly impacting their shooting and passing accuracy.

  • Customization Options: Many manufacturers offer customizable shafts, allowing players to choose specifics like length and shape. Research by Smith et al. (2021) shows that personalized shafts can lead to an improved sense of control and confidence based on preferred weight distribution.

  • Player Preference: Ultimately, the choice of shaft shape boils down to player preference. An individual may favor a lighter, more agile shaft, while another may prefer a heavier, more stable option. Player feedback often guides the design and material choices in modern lacrosse sticks.

These factors collectively illustrate how various shaft shapes can dramatically alter the dynamic weight distribution, directly impacting player performance on the field.
